Transaction 31376328a026c5112aed821877d9d98e2212dc8c325c31e0bb2a061c07dcacbb

2 Input
2 Outputs
  • 31376328a026c5112aed821877d9d98e2212dc8c325c31e0bb2a061c07dcacbb:0
  • value  38000000
    address  2MyCRbBcbv5Gt88T1eWgnzpnJcZJFPVZXBU
  • 31376328a026c5112aed821877d9d98e2212dc8c325c31e0bb2a061c07dcacbb:1
  • value  1099397
    address  2Mt2423KYcvfRhUTK2Zdhorr5QwmEdNf1Ao